"Many people believe that hotter water is better, but in fact, for the purposes of removing germs, there is no good evidence that water temperature matters," Borwein says. (n.d). 2. 3. And although viruses don't set up shop on the skin the way bacteria do, the viruses that cause diarrhea and respiratory infections from the sniffles to the flu can hang around on the hands long enough to spread from person to person. Just 30 seconds of simple handwashing with soap and water reduces the bacterial count on health care workers' hands by 58%.
